Description The results showed that miR-122 could bind specifically to the 5' and 3' end of target mRNAs of BDV encoding for N and P proteins, both on two positions (Fig. 1B). These results indicated that BDV persistent infection and BDV P and N proteins were able to suppress the expression of miR-122.
